Ugx. 216,775,150
View detail
Ugx. 255,714,030
Ugx. 189,667,230
Ugx. 176,894,380
Ugx. 209,825,600
Ugx. 207,401,820
Ugx. 198,357,980
Ugx. 163,778,990
Ugx. 198,542,320
Ugx. 110,518,120
Ugx. 149,028,700
Ugx. 155,931,550